Default Ringbrothers GM Door Handles

Stock is coming in on the GM door handles. Holy smokes - I never thought I would consider a car part beautiful but these things are amazing! The standard finish will be polished and from there you can do a lot of different combinations. We are trying to determine what to offer... let me know what you think of these different options.








So... anyone in on the group buy back in September got a smokin deal! I promised to honor that price so I will. The actual retail is going to be $349.99. It turns out that they are more difficult to machine than the Mustang handle which is what we were basing our pricing off.
This is higher than we ever intended but the piece is absolutely amazing so we couldn't just scrap it.
